Unlike other shows in Bali, this dinner show immerses the audience and involves them in the show. When you arrive, you choose which “side” you want to be on. The Lemurian side: connected to people and nature. The Atlantian side: connected to technology and productivity. The dancing also includes 3 fire dances and the story transports you back to the…

Great experience (but steep stairs) - Very important to know - The access to the stage/restaurant is only for the able bodied as it has lots of very steep stairs!! This is an interactive show so be prepared to get amongst it! The show wasnt what we expected but still thoroughly enjoyed it. Would suggest a little more instruction but for an experience in its infancy it was great and can only get better. The food was fantastic and the team were lovely.

Not Bali related but entertaining - Definitely has nothing to do with Bali. Was entertained by the dancers and setting but wish it was more Bali related. Not even the food is a Balinese experience since it is more a copy of Mongolian Grill where one selects raw food/spices and they cook it. Other thing to consider is that it takes 90 minutes to get here from the major Bali hotels located in Nusa Dua.
